The energy intensity of the green light spot is only 7200.
Seven thousand two, that's ninety-nine thousand nine!
The huge numerical difference felt like a boulder weighing on everyone's hearts.
Even though they had heard of Lin Yi's strength, and even though they believed that the General Staff would not make baseless accusations, the stark contrast of these cold statistics still made them uneasy.
"Can this really work?" an adjutant couldn't help but mutter to himself.
Zhang Weiguo did not answer; he simply pursed his lips and stared intently at the screen.
-
Inside the small flying ball, Lin Yi estimated that the distance was about right, and the scorching, violent aura was already as obvious as a torch in his perception.
"Hover, open the hatch," he calmly gave the command.
"Command confirmed," the cold, electronic voice replied.
The small flying ball instantly went from extreme motion to extreme stillness, hovering steadily high in the city sky.
The hatch slid open, and Lin Yi stepped out, his figure already firmly standing in the void.
This time, he did not choose to launch an attack from a distance, but instead moved to a relatively close distance.
Because the distance is closer, the control is stronger.
Lin Yi thought that it was best to preserve the landmark building, Zifeng Tower, for Jinling City as much as possible. If an attack was launched from a distance, it might just be destroyed.
At this moment, the Blazing Rock Python, which was coiled on the Zifeng Tower in the distance, seemed to have also noticed the uninvited guest.
Its ferocious python head slowly rose, its dark red diamond-shaped pupils piercing through a space of more than ten kilometers, locking onto the tiny human in the air who exuded a dangerous aura.
Between the gaps in its dark purple obsidian scales, a crimson light, like lava, began to emanate faintly, and the surrounding air began to distort due to the high temperature.
Lin Yi remained expressionless, not even glancing at the giant python's defiant posture.
He slowly raised his right hand, his five fingers slightly spread.
In an instant, a dozen small steel balls emerged from his waist in succession, like a living metal tide, arranging and combining in an orderly fashion in front of him.
On the surface of each steel ball, fine golden and crimson electric snakes began to leap.
Immediately, the golden and red lightning bolts intertwined and devoured each other, eventually condensing into black lightning bolts that seemed capable of absorbing all light.
The black electric light flowed silently across the surface of each small steel ball, without emitting the slightest energy fluctuation, yet it suddenly froze the fiery obsidian python that had been restless in the distance.
An overwhelming sense of crisis, like an animal's instinct, was poured over its head like ice water, causing its lava-like pupils to suddenly shrink to the size of pinpoints.
It wanted to roar, to explode, to spew all the scorching magma within its body at the source of the threat.
But it was too late.
Lin Yi gently closed his slightly open fingers.
"laugh--!"
The small steel ball, crackling with black electricity, vanished from its spot in an instant.
They did not fly in a straight line, but rather, as if they were teleporting, they left countless tiny, distorted black trails in the air, piercing through the Blazing Rock Serpent's enormous head and entire body from all directions.
After all, with snakes, sometimes simply cutting off their heads isn't enough.
The roar that the Blazing Rock Python was about to unleash was abruptly cut off in its throat.
Its massive body trembled violently, its dark red pupils dimmed instantly, losing all their luster, and the body that was wrapped around the building lost its strength and began to slide down.
however.
"puff"
As soon as the enormous python body plummeted, it was like a punctured balloon, turning into countless extremely fine dark red energy dust particles from the inside out.
Like a silent sandstorm, it drifted away without causing any additional damage to the main structure of the Zifeng Tower below.
A single, fist-sized, azure-blue crystal with mysterious golden patterns flowing across its surface condensed and appeared where the giant python's head had originally been, and began to fall under the influence of gravity.
With a thought, Lin Yi steadily captured the golden-patterned blue crystal and placed it in his palm. He briefly sensed the information contained within the golden-patterned blue crystal, and a smile involuntarily appeared on his lips.
"Not bad, a great start. The very first crystal yielded a flying vehicle, and a decent one at that—the Starburst Fighter."
Since he could use it, Lin Yi simply crushed the crystal.
The crystal fragments first transformed into a blue light, and then, in a slight spatial distortion, they transformed into countless streamlined blue light bands. These light bands, as if they had a life of their own, rapidly wove, outlined, and condensed in front of Lin Yi.
As the light faded, a brand-new aircraft was revealed.
Its body is streamlined and spindle-shaped, with a deep dark blue shell, like a frozen night sky. It is about five meters long, which is more slender and agile than the previous small flying ball.
The aircraft's smooth hull rippled open to reveal an entrance, much like waves on water.
As soon as Lin Yi stepped inside, the entrance closed silently and quickly.
The aircraft's interior is simple yet comfortable, featuring an ergonomically designed command seat and a light screen projecting a 360-degree panoramic image of the surroundings, making all data clear and intuitive.
A clear voice rang out.
[“Starlight” is on standby. It has automatically bound and identified the current life form as the highest-authority holder. Armament, propulsion, life support, and stealth systems have completed self-checks and are in good condition. Awaiting instructions.]
"It does have low-level intelligence, which makes things much more convenient."
Lin Yi made a mental assessment, then instructed, "Briefly introduce the core data."
The electronic sound of starlight rang out.
"Okay, here's a brief introduction to the starburst parameters:"
Speed: Maximum cruising speed can reach 4000 km/h, and burst speed can reach 8000 km/h.
"Armor: Equipped with a 'high-frequency particle beam array' and a 'miniature energy missile pod,' the intelligent system assesses and can effectively intercept, drive away, or annihilate conventional units with an energy value below 30000 points."
"Concealment: It has optical camouflage and energy fluctuation shielding functions, making it difficult to detect without targeted high-intensity detection."
"Intelligent control: Built-in tactical analysis, environmental scanning, automatic evasion, combat-assisted locking and other functions."
Lin Yi nodded to himself. Although it wasn't the best one he could get from the golden-patterned blue crystal, and the speed wasn't fast, it was still pretty good.
He took out his phone and ordered, "Scan data information, confirm destination: Helu City Academy Headquarters. Maximum cruising speed."
"Command confirmation."
Then, "Starburst" trembled slightly, and several vector nozzles at its tail instantly spewed out streams of dark blue particles.
The next moment, the entire aircraft, like a blue lightning bolt tearing through the sky, instantly broke through the clouds and sped towards Crane Deer City, leaving behind only the silent city and the skyscraper that had finally escaped the demon's clutches.
Monitoring and analysis room at the Jinling settlement.
Deathly silence.
Zhang Weiguo and all the staff were frozen in place, staring dumbfounded at the holographic screen.
Just now, they saw the green dot representing Lin Yi stop fifteen kilometers away from the scarlet marker. And then... nothing happened.
There was no earth-shattering energy collision as imagined, nor a prolonged and intense confrontation.
Just two or three seconds after the green dot paused, the glaring scarlet logo on the screen vanished as if wiped away by an invisible hand.
Clean and efficient, without any warning.
In the monitoring room, only the faint hum of the instruments could be heard.
Several seconds passed before Zhang Weiguo snapped back to reality. He blinked hard to make sure the scarlet marker was truly gone. He opened his mouth, feeling his throat dry. In the end, all his emotions boiled down to a single sigh, echoing in the deathly quiet monitoring room:
"No wonder. No wonder he was invited to the highest-level meeting."
